  8. Case 1: Meridian Insurance goes agentic RELEASE 1 RELEASE 2

    RELEASE 3 RELEASE 4 Chatbot advice Outbound offers Contract optimisation Autonomous pricing Answers cover questions and recommends a product. A human writes every quote. The system drafts and sends renewal and cross-sell offers on its own. It reshapes cover, excess and clauses per customer to hit margin targets. It sets and charges the premium, and books the contract without review. Who is now in the loop Policyholders and brokers · call-centre advisors · underwriters and pricing actuaries · product owner · risk, compliance, and the DPO · model and platform engineers · the vendor behind the model · the regulator and the ombudsman · the board The shift: nothing new was added at Release 4. The same system simply stopped asking. Accountability did not move with the decision.
  9. Talking About Ethics vs. Acting Ethically Talking About Ethics A

    human engages with an LLM to explore and understand moral questions. The AI reflects, explains, and surfaces ethical considerations, but takes no action. Advising on Decisions The AI system provides genuine ethical recommendations, flagging risks, scoring options, or suggesting courses of action. The human retains final authority but is guided by the system's moral reasoning. Agentic Action The AI acts autonomously in an open-loop manner, executing decisions without human approval at each step. Direct implications on responsibility, accountability, and cascading consequences.

  12. Case 3: Transportation services What can and cannot be delegated

    when the AI dispatches real vehicles to real people Meaningful human control Pre-set triggers hand the ride to a human: distressed or duress wording, and time × location × age cross-checks. Responsibility without accountability One named escalation path: who takes the alert, who overrides dispatch, who answers afterwards. i.e., a supervisor on shift above AI. Quality vs. resources Human review is the first cost cut. Policy sets the floor: review budget, sampling rate, and securing margins. Non-delegable: the decision to send a vulnerable passenger into a vehicle, alone, at night. The AI may flag it, a person must own it.

  18. Case 4: A utility with 40,000 IoT endpoints Agents at

    substations, meters and inverters negotiate load directly with each other Efficient, illegible Scale as attack surface No locus of accountability Agent-to-agent messages compress to codes no operator reads. Dispatch drops from minutes to seconds, and the audit trail becomes vectors, not sentences. 40,000 endpoints are 40,000 injection points. A spoofed price or tariff signal propagates fleet-wide before the first human alert is opened. A district that goes dark is the sum of thousands of local decisions, a vendor model, and a tariff API. Nobody authored it. The oversight trade: every gain in machine-to-machine efficiency removes a place where a human could have looked.
  19. The four shifts at Meridian Insurance 1. Changing Roles &

    Responsibilities 2. The Authority Gradient Advisors become exception handlers. The product owner now owns pricing logic she cannot read, while the vendor owns the model behind it. Nobody can name the person who authored a given quote. The machine price becomes the default. Accepting the agent costs nothing; overriding it needs written justification and a manager. Authority quietly moves from the actuary to whoever configured the margin target. 3. The Complacency Problem 4. Automation Bias Oversight decays with success. Approval rates reach ~99% by month three, sampling falls from 10% to 2%, and the exception queue is worked at speed. SME loss-ratio drift is spotted two quarters late. Contradicting evidence gets discounted. Staff assume the model 'saw more data' and wave through a mispriced renewal, despite a claims note in the file. Complaints are answered with the model output rather than the facts. Controls that hold: a named accountable human per decision type, mandatory rotating sample audits, override and challenge rates tracked as KPIs, and a documented reason for every price a customer can contest.
